You’ll be seen by a certified orthopedic physician assistant with advanced training and expertise in the diagnosis and treatment of orthopedic (muscle, bone and joint) injuries. An OPA on-call surgeon is available for immediate consultation as needed. On-site x-ray and other imaging services ensure patients receive quick, personalized care that includes a diagnosis, treatment plan and any necessary stabilization devices such as crutches, braces or casts to get you on the road to recovery.
